Who we are

The Brahma Kumaris is a nonsectarian, non-governmental organization. We welcome people from all walks of life, religion, race or creed. Through meditation, we seek to help people rediscover goodness from within and encourage the development of spiritual awareness, attitude and behavior. Brahma Kumaris Meditation courses and spiritual programs are offered in over 8,000 centers across 130 countries.

In the Philippines, the Brahma Kumaris Philippines Spiritual Foundation, Inc. was established in 1985. It is governed by a Board of Trustees that provides the appropriate policies and directions for the effective and efficient operations of the organization. The Brahma Kumaris Philippines is a recipient of the UN Peace Messenger Award.

Our spiritual headquarters in Mount Abu, Rajasthan India has a general consultative status with the Economic and Social Council of the United Nations, in consultative status with UNICEF, and affiliated to the UN Department of Public Information.

Vision

A world where people of all cultural, economic, social, and religious backgrounds live in harmony with others to rediscover and develop the spiritual dimension of their lives.

Mission

The Brahma Kumaris World Spiritual University Phil. Foundation, Inc. helps people to rediscover their intrinsic spirituality and goodness, encouraging and facilitating the development of spiritual awareness, attitudes, behaviors and skills through a process of lifelong learning.

Values

Our consciousness affects our values. Our values form the basis of our actions which in turn determine the nature and extent of our contribution and impact to the society in which we live. The Brahma Kumaris in the Philippines continues to explore the connection between the consciousness of the individual as well as its collective effect on our precious world.
